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and decreases convenience. Our HVAC specialists recognize air flow issues, whether caused by duct concerns, filthy fil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can diagnose these issues and recommend sol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off often, it loses energy and wears parts quicker. Our HVAC contractors can figure out whether the problem originates from a blocked fil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den boosts in energy expenses often show H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ors perform energy effectiveness evaluations to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can recommend services to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what appears like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can fix or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ise models for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the location of your HVAC devices and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Routine expert upkeep reduces the probability of emergencies. Our HVAC professionals can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ors provide an early caution of dangerous leakages.
